다음을 통해 공유


HolographicCamera 클래스

정의

HolographicDisplay에서 HolographicViewConfiguration에 대한 프레임별 렌더링 기능을 제공합니다.

public ref class HolographicCamera sealed
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 131072)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
/// [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
class HolographicCamera final
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 131072)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
[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
public sealed class HolographicCamera
Public NotInheritable Class HolographicCamera
상속
Object Platform::Object IInspectable HolographicCamera
특성

Windows 요구 사항

디바이스 패밀리
Windows 10 (10.0.10586.0 - for Xbox, see UWP features that aren't yet supported on Xbox에서 도입되었습니다.)
API contract
Windows.Foundation.UniversalApiContract (v2.0에서 도입되었습니다.)

설명

앱은 각 HolographicFrame을 표시하기 전에 하나 이상의 HolographicCamera에 대해 백 버퍼로 렌더링됩니다.

버전 기록

Windows 버전 SDK 버전 추가된 값
1703 15063 표시
1703 15063 LeftViewportParameters
1703 15063 RightViewportParameters
1709 16299 IsPrimaryLayerEnabled
1709 16299 MaxQuadLayerCount
1709 16299 QuadLayers
1803 17134 CanOverrideViewport
1809 17763 IsHardwareContentProtectionEnabled
1809 17763 IsHardwareContentProtectionSupported
1903 18362 ViewConfiguration

속성

CanOverrideViewport

디스플레이가 뷰포트 사각형 재정의를 지원하는지 여부를 가져옵니다.

Display

이 HolographicCamera가 나타내는 디스플레이에 대한 메타데이터를 가져옵니다.

Id

HolographicCamera의 고유 식별자를 가져옵니다.

IsHardwareContentProtectionEnabled

HolographicCamera 가 기본 계층에 대한 하드웨어로 보호된 백 버퍼를 생성할지 여부를 가져오거나 설정합니다.

IsHardwareContentProtectionSupported

HolographicCamera에 대해 하드웨어 콘텐츠 보호가 지원되는지 여부를 가져옵니다.

IsPrimaryLayerEnabled

이 카메라가 앱으로 채워진 기본 백 버퍼를 표시할지 여부를 가져오거나 설정합니다.

IsStereo

현재 디스플레이가 모노가 아닌 스테레오인지 여부를 가져옵니다.

LeftViewportParameters

디스플레이의 왼쪽 눈 뷰포트와 관련된 렌더링 매개 변수를 가져옵니다.

MaxQuadLayerCount

현재 시스템에서 지원하는 최대 쿼드 계층 수를 가져옵니다.

QuadLayers

이 카메라의 기본 백 버퍼 위에 표시할 쿼드 계층의 변경 가능한 목록을 가져옵니다.

RenderTargetSize

이 카메라에 할당된 백 버퍼의 크기를 픽셀 단위로 가져옵니다.

RightViewportParameters

디스플레이의 오른쪽 눈 뷰포트와 관련된 렌더링 매개 변수를 가져옵니다.

ViewConfiguration

HolographicCamera가 렌더링을 제공하는 HolographicViewConfiguration을 가져옵니다.

ViewportScaleFactor

기본 뷰포트 크기에 적용할 배율 인수를 가져오거나 설정합니다.

메서드

SetFarPlaneDistance(Double)

보기 공간의 원점에서 보기 frustum의 먼 평면까지 z축을 따라 거리를 설정합니다.

SetNearPlaneDistance(Double)

뷰 공간의 원점에서 뷰 frustum의 가까운 평면까지 z축을 따라 거리를 설정합니다.

적용 대상

추가 정보